The EGO Power+ AC1800 18-Inch Chain Saw Chain is engineered for compatibility with EGO 18-Inch Chainsaw models CS1800 and CS1804. Featuring a low kickback design that adheres to safety standards, this chain boasts a 0.050 in. gauge and 3/8 in. low pro pitch for optimal cutting performance. Crafted from genuine EGO parts, it ensures quality and durability for all your outdoor projects.
Chain Type | Low Profile |
Pitch | 0.38 Inches |
Chain Length | 18 Inches |
Item Length | 18 Inches |
